This drunken pumpkin seeds recipe is not your grandma's pumpkin seeds recipe! Smokey, sweet, and wonderfully delicious.
Ingredients
- 1.5 cups fresh pumpkin seeds
- 0.5 cups whiskey , such as Jack Daniel's
- 2 tablespoons bacon drippings
- 1 tablespoon dark brown sugar
- 2 teaspoons salt , plus more to taste
Instructions
-
1
Preheat the oven to 275 degrees F (135 degrees C).
-
2
Combine pumpkin seeds, whiskey, bacon drippings, brown sugar, and 2 teaspoons salt together in a saucepan over medium-low heat; bring to a simmer and cook until seeds begin to turn gray in the middle, 15 to 20 minutes. Drain.
-
3
Spread pumpkin seeds on a baking sheet in a single layer; season with salt.
-
4
Roast in the preheated oven until crisp and golden brown, 1 to 1 ยฝ hours.
